Partager via


Day, fonction (Visual Basic)

Mise à jour : novembre 2007

Retourne une valeur Integer comprise entre 1 et 31 représentant le jour du mois.

Public Function Day(ByVal DateValue As DateTime) As Integer

Paramètres

  • DateValue
    Requis. Valeur Date de laquelle vous souhaitez extraire le jour.

Notes

Si vous utilisez la fonction Day, vous devrez peut-être la qualifier à l'aide de l'espace de noms Microsoft.VisualBasic, parce que l'espace de noms System.Windows.Forms définit Day comme une énumération. L'exemple suivant montre comment la qualification de Day permet de résoudre cette ambiguïté :

Dim thisDay As Integer = Microsoft.VisualBasic.DateAndTime.Day(Now)

Vous pouvez également obtenir le jour du mois en appelant DatePart et en spécifiant DateInterval.Day pour l'argument Intervalle.

Exemple

L'exemple suivant utilise la fonction Day pour obtenir le jour du mois à partir d'une date spécifiée. Dans l'environnement de développement, le littéral de date est affiché sous le format de date courte standard (par exemple "02/12/1969") en utilisant les paramètres régionaux de votre code.

Dim oldDate As Date
Dim oldDay As Integer
' Assign a date using standard short format.
oldDate = #2/12/1969#
oldDay = Microsoft.VisualBasic.DateAndTime.Day(oldDate)
' oldDay now contains 12.

La fonction Day est qualifiée pour se distinguer de l'énumération System.Windows.Forms.Day.

Configuration requise

Espace de noms :Microsoft.VisualBasic

**Module :**DateAndTime

**Assembly :**bibliothèque Visual Basic Runtime (dans Microsoft.VisualBasic.dll)

Voir aussi

Référence

DatePart, fonction (Visual Basic)

Month, fonction (Visual Basic)

Now, propriété

Weekday, fonction (Visual Basic)

Year, fonction (Visual Basic)

DateTime

ArgumentException

ArgumentOutOfRangeException